This Week

MONDAY - 15

EXHIBITION: Walking through the Past - from Enlightenment to Biedermeier is designed for antique collectors. It includes Baroque, Empire and Biedermeier paintings, and furniture from 1750 to 1850.
Admission: 10-30 Sk. Open: Mon-Fri 10:00-17:00 and Sat-Sun 11:00-18:00. Stará radnica (Old Town Hall), Primaciálne námestie 3. Tel: 02/5443-4742. Running until November 15.


TUESDAY - 16

CLASSICAL CONCERT: The Slovak Albrecht Quartet and Accordion Quintet perform Ludwig van Beethoven, A. Albrecht, H. Ambrosius and A. Piazzolla.
Tickets: 40 Sk (on sale at the Town Culture Centre, Uršulínka 11, Tel: 02/5443-2942). Starts at 19:00. Koncertná sieň Klarisky (Klarisky Concert Hall), Farská 4.


WEDNESDAY -17

LIVE MUSIC: Donau Monarchie Jazz Band. Pianist Pavol Bodnár, bassist Andrej Šebo and drummer Csaba Csendes perform at Hystéria pub, in Bratislava's Zimný štadión (Winter Stadium).
Admission free. Starts at 20:30. Hystéria pub, Odbojárov 9. Tel: 02/4445-4495. www.hysteria-pub.sk


THURSDAY - 18

LIVE DUO-CONCERT: The Slovak Jewish folk Pressburger Klezmer Band performs with the Macedonian/French Slonovski Bal brass band.
Tickets: 160-200 Sk (on sale at Dr. Horák, Medená 19, Tel: 02/5443-5667). Starts at 20:00. DK Zrkadlový Háj, Klub Za zrkadlom, Rovniankova 3. Tel: 02/6381-1328.


FRIDAY - 19

METAL CONCERT: Slovak bands Ethercal Pandemonium and Dead Poets Society share the stage with Austrian and Czech hard-core bands Vanitas and Pikodeath.
Tickets: 80 Sk. Starts at 18:00. Dom Kultúry Dúbravka (Dúbravka Culture House), Saratovská 2/A. Tel: 02/6436-5610. www.dkd. host.sk


SATURDAY - 20

OPERA: The Bartered Bride by Bedřich Smetana. A Czech opera known for cheerful music and comic characters.
Tickets: 50-180 Sk (on sale at the SND's Central Box office, Komenské námestie, Tel: 02/5443-3890, 5443-3764). Starts at 19:00. Slovenské Národné Divadlo (Slovak National Theatre - SND), Hviezdoslavovo námestie 1.


SUNDAY - 21

EXHIBITION: Design's Dimensions - 100 classical chairs. The German Vitra Design Museum exhibits miniature chairs. The chairs are original workman's models from 1800 to 1990.
Admission 10-50 Sk. Open daily except Mon 10:00-18:00. Esterházy Palace of Slovenská národná galéria (Slovak National Gallery) on Námestie Ľudovíta Štúra 4. Tel: 02/5443-4587
